Thanks,Auggie and Lancy I have made this specific trip twice; once in '07 and again late in '08.At that time there was not a NS flight direct to SEA from CAN. I had to take Nippon Air from CAN to NRT (Tokyo) and then the nonstop from NRT to SEA on Northwest. When I got round trip ticket from Seattle to Guangzhou, I usually buy from AA Travel in Seattle Chinatown. It is right below from Fort St George Restaurant. Their price is fair. Last July and Sept, I paid about $800 and $850 for Hainan Airlines in July and Korean Air in September. I heard recently there is another travel agency opened in the Key Bank building in Chinatown. Their price is about $5 to $10 cheaper than AA, but I haven't had the chance to buy from them. If you are already in China, sorry... I don't know any websites.
